A qualitative exploration of the experiences of primary care patients engaged in email counseling meant to increase physical activity

Abstract: several recent larger trials in primary care confirm the positive effects of pedometer-based PA counseling, these studies also show that the effectiveness of these interventions is far from optimal (Harris et al., 2015), especially in the long term (Harris et al., 2017; Yates et al., 2017). Therefore, the factors that influence patients' effort to increase and maintain their PA need to be explored and elucidated.
